REVERB12 | DAILY PROMPTS
December 01 | One Word (the original first question)
Encapsulate the year 2012 in one word. Explain why you're choosing that word. Now, imagine it's one year from today, what would you like the word to be that captures 2013 for you? (Author: Gwen Bell)
December 02 | Limits
We often learn our limits the hard way. Were there any limits you realized this past year? Alternately, what self-imposed limits were you able to move beyond this year? (Author: Carolyn Rubenstein)
December 03 | Remember
What is one thing you did this year you think you'll remember for the rest of your life? (Author: Me)
December 04 | Fear
When were you most scared? Why? How did you respond? How do you wish you would have responded? (Author: Mary Churchill)
December 05 | Worthy
Who have you taken for granted? Write to them a handwritten letter expressing how you truly feel about them. Then mail it. (Author: Me)
December 06 | Change
If you could change one thing that happened this year, what would it be? Why? (Author: Me)
December 07 | 7 Minutes
Imagine you will completely lose your memory of 2012 in 7 minutes. Set an alarm for 7 minutes and capture the things you most want to remember about 2012. (Author: Patty Digh, with an extra 2 minutes from me!)
December 08 | Reading
What has been your favourite book or blog or magazine you've read this year? (Author: Carolyn Rubenstein)
December 09 | Spontaneity
What was your last act of spontaneity? (Author: Me)
December 10 | Accomplish
What are the 10 things I'm most proud of accomplishing this year? What are 10 things on the to do list for next year? (Author: Me)
December 11 | Money
Where did you spend money through this year? (Author: Kaileen Elise)
December 12 | Joy
What activity brings you the most joy? (Author: Me)
December 13 | Try
What do you want to try next year? Is there something you wanted to try 2012? What happened when you did/didn't go for it. (Author: Kaileen Elise)
December 14 | Relaxed
Where did you feel most relaxed? (Author: Me)
December 15 | Make
What was the last thing you made? What materials did you use? Is there something you want to make, but you need to clear some time for it? (Author: Gretchen Rubin)
December 16 | Disappointment
What was the greatest disappointment of the year and how did you let go? (Author: Me)
December 17 | Spark
What in your current life or context provides the spark for the future that you want to create? Where do you see your future beginning? (Author: Me)
December 18 | Bouquet
If you were to be brought a bouquet, what flowers would you want it to hold? Colourful? Monochromatic? Traditional? Modern? (Author: Me)
December 19 | Cry
When did you cry? (Author: Kaileen Elise)
December 20 | Health
Do you consider yourself to be in good health? What changes can you make to be at your most healthy? (Author: Me)
December 21 | Song
What were your favourite songs? (Author: Kaileen Elise)
December 22 | Discovery
Did you discover something that surprised or delighted you? What was it? (Author: Me)
December 23 | Alone
Have you had any alone time this year? Do you seek it? Does it make you comfortable or uncomfortable to be left alone with your thoughts? Where is the best place for you to be comfortable by yourself? (Author: Me)
December 24 | Photograph
Take some time and wander through all of the photos taken over the past year. Which is your favourite? What emotions do you associate with it? (Author: Me)
December 25 | Gift
At this point in the year gift giving is everywhere. What is the most memorable gift, tangible or emotional, you received this year? (Author: Holly Root)
December 26 | Return
Is there a time to which you would like to return? Describe it: the sights, sounds, smells, who was there, what was going on. Why would you like to return? (Author: Me)
December 27 | Compliment
What is the greatest compliment you could give? Are you worthy of the same praise? (Author: Me)
December 28 | Space
We all surround ourselves with the things we love. A few favourite things - a blanket, a lamp, a piece of art, a chair, a lovey - something inanimate that brings us happiness. What do you have in your personal space that brings about happiness? What is the story attached to it that has it in your sacred space? (Author: Me)
December 29 | View
Imagine that you can view yourself from above. Watch carefully. What are you doing? What are you trying to accomplish? As objectively as possible, are you going in the right direction? (Author: Me)
December 30 | Year in Review
As you reflect back on the happenings of 2012, what were your high points and what were your low points? What do you notice as you look back on the year as a whole? (Author: Carolyn Rubenstein)
December 31 | Moving Forward
Close your eyes and imagine yourself on January 1, 2014. Where do you want to be - in your heart, in your soul, in the world? (Author: Me)
